Shift Manager Jobs in New Jersey: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ies sponsor visas for shift managers in New Jersey?

Large employers in New Jersey with established sponsorship track records for operational roles include companies in logistics and warehousing near Newark Liberty International Airport, national quick-service restaurant chains with corporate-managed locations, and hotel groups operating in the Meadowlands and Atlantic City areas. Retailers with New Jersey distribution centers, such as those along the Route 1 corridor in Middlesex County, also sponsor shift management positions periodically.

Which visa types are most common for shift manager roles in New Jersey?

The H-1B visa is the most commonly pursued visa for shift managers in New Jersey, though it requires the role to qualify as a specialty occupation, which can be challenging for operations-focused positions without a degree requirement tied to the specific field. Candidates with degrees in hospitality management, supply chain, or business administration have a stronger case. TN visas apply to Canadian and Mexican nationals in qualifying management categories.

Which cities in New Jersey have the most shift manager sponsorship jobs?

Newark, Edison, and Jersey City tend to have the highest concentration of shift manager sponsorship activity in New Jersey. Newark's status as a major logistics and transit hub drives demand in warehousing and distribution. Edison and the broader Middlesex County area attract retail and food service operations. Jersey City's proximity to Manhattan makes it a secondary hub for hospitality and service industry employers who sponsor international workers.

Are there state-specific considerations for shift manager visa sponsorship in New Jersey?

New Jersey's prevailing wage requirements, determined by the Department of Labor for H-1B filings, reflect the state's relatively high cost of living, meaning sponsored shift managers must be paid at or above the certified prevailing wage for their county and occupational classification. New Jersey's dense population and high operational volume across logistics, retail, and hospitality mean employers are often more experienced with sponsorship processes than in smaller markets, but competition for sponsored roles remains significant.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ored shift manager jobs in New Jersey?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
